"Left, Right, Left" (also known as "Left/Right") is the lead single released from Drama's debut album, Causin' Drama. The song was produced by Shawty Redd, with Drama both co-producing and writing it.

The song peaked at #73 on the Billboard Hot 100, #18 on the R&B chart, and #2 on the rap chart.
